ACM编程竞赛是目前计算机领域最具挑战性的竞赛之一,尤其是对于计算机科学与技术专业的学生而言,ACM是非常重要的一项竞技活动。在ACM比赛中,裁判对于程序的评测是非常关键的,而现在有一款虚拟裁判软件——virtualjudge,能够帮助学生更好地进行ACM训练和比赛。
virtualjudge是一款基于浏览器的虚拟裁判软件,它的主要功能是模拟ACM编程竞赛中的评判过程,为参赛者提供实时的错误信息和反馈。virtualjudge支持多种编程语言,比如C、C++、Java等,还支持多种操作系统,方便大家在各种环境下进行练习。
virtualjudge的界面非常直观友好,它不仅能够模拟ACM比赛中的场景,还能够提供练习题目和代码库,帮助学员加深对计算机程序设计的理解和实操能力。此外,virtualjudge还有自动评测功能,即在程序提交后,系统会自动运行程序,并将结果以最快的速度返回给用户,非常方便。
对于ACM初学者而言,virtualjudge是一个非常好的学习工具。学生可以借助它学习各种算法与数据结构,并在虚拟裁判的评测环境中进行训练和调试,提高解决问题和编码能力。与此同时,virtualjudge还提供一些例题和教程,使学生能够更加深入地学习ACM的知识和技能。
值得一提的是,虚拟裁判软件虽然非常有用,但并不代表全部。学生们需要在实际比赛中经历,才能更好地了解其中奥妙。ACM编程竞赛是多方评估的,比赛过程也需要考虑心思、排练和经验等因素。因此,在考虑使用virtualjudge的同时,学生们还需要配合实际操作和切实经验,才能真正成为一名好的ACM选手。
总之,学生们应该多加尝试和使用,结合实际比赛场景的训练和调试,可以提高ACM的实战水平,进一步发展自己的计算机专业生涯。